The Majesty of Trail Ridge Road

Our guide, David, met us with a warm smile and an infectious enthusiasm for the journey ahead. As we began our ascent along Trail Ridge Road, I was struck by the sheer majesty of the landscape. Each curve in the road revealed a new vista, more breathtaking than the last. The air was crisp and clear, the sky a brilliant blue that seemed to stretch on forever.

David’s knowledge of the area was impressive, and his stories brought the history and geology of the Rockies to life. He pointed out the peaks that towered above us, each with its own story to tell. Longs Peak, with its imposing height, stood as a silent guardian over the park, a challenge to those who seek to conquer its summit.

As we drove, we were treated to sightings of the park’s diverse wildlife. Elk grazed peacefully in the meadows, while birds of prey soared overhead. It was a reminder of the delicate balance of nature, a world where every creature has its place. The experience was both humbling and exhilarating, a chance to witness the wonders of the natural world up close.

A Touch of History at the Stanley Hotel

On our return journey, we made a stop at the Stanley Hotel, a place steeped in history and intrigue. Known for its connection to Stephen King’s “The Shining,” the hotel exudes an air of mystery that is both captivating and slightly eerie. As we wandered through its halls, I couldn’t help but imagine the stories that have unfolded within its walls over the years.

The hotel, with its grand architecture and stunning views, was the perfect end to our day of exploration. It was a reminder of the rich tapestry of history that is woven into the fabric of the American West.
